Sports Betting Analyst
 
Company:  SimpleBet 
Location:   New York City 
About the Company:
SimpleBet is developing the world's simplest, most intuitive betting products - for everyone ranging from hardcore sports viewers to the casual fans. The company is also building a system of proprietary machine learning algorithms and technology systems to generate in-house pricing for our uniquely reimagined betting products, with a heavy focus on live in-game betting.
 
SimpleBet is well capitalized, and is led by a veteran team of successful entrepreneurs, executives, engineers, and data scientists with valuable experiences and relationships across sports (daily fantasy and otherwise), media, product development, and technology. 
About the Role:
We are seeking an experienced analyst to help build our cutting-edge suite of machine learning-based sports betting products and predictive engines. You will be an integral part of the Sports Betting Analytics team. Working alongside our Data Science team, you will play a pivotal role by maximizing the value of our data and helping SimpleBet reach the growth targets set up for the coming years. 
To excel in this role, you need first-rate problem solving skills, an interest in the sports and betting markets, as well as experience with statistics, machine learning, data structures and algorithms, and computer science fundamentals.
Responsibilities:
  • Provide key stakeholders with valuable, actionable insights pertaining to the optimization of sportsbook management
  • Contribute to the development of algorithms that will be used to predict the outcome of sporting events
  • Research trends in the sports and gaming industry to stay on top of new developments
  • Apply statistical methods to analyze, interpret, and operationalize data with respect to risk management, finance, customer integration, evaluating problem gamblers, and GDPR.
  • Promote and operationalize data-led decision making across SimpleBet
  • Identify opportunities where data can make a positive impact
  • Build and maintain partnerships with key industry stakeholders (e.g. professional sports leagues, data providers, operators, etc.)
Skills:
  •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in STEM field from a top accredited university
  • Significant experience in highly quantitative/analytical role utilizing large data sets
  • Expertise and passion for sports and the related betting markets
  • Experience in sports analytics is strongly preferred
  • Understanding of programming and computer science fundamentals
  • Strong knowledge of statistics and probability
  • Basic understanding of machine learning algorithms
  • Understanding of Python, SQL, R, or related data processing languages
  • Strong command of Microsoft Excel/VBA or other data processing software
 
Expected Salary: 80k to 130k + Equity
